Understanding the Immediate Steps Post-Accident
Assessing Injuries and Safety

Examine yourself and others for injuries. If possible, relocate to a safe place far from traffic. If somebody is hurt, call emergency services instantly.
Key Points:
- Ensure security first Call for medical assistance Avoid moving seriously hurt people unless necessary
Calling the Authorities
Once everybody is safe, it's important to call police. A police report will document the event and provide a main account that may be critical for insurance coverage declares later on on.
Exchanging Information
Gather essential info from all celebrations associated with the mishap:
- Names and contact details Insurance details Vehicle registration numbers Driver's license numbers
This information is important for any legal procedures or insurance coverage claims that might follow.
What to Do After an Automobile Accident: Legal Considerations
Documenting the Scene
Taking photos of the accident scene can be indispensable when filing claims or pursuing legal action. Capture pictures of:
- Vehicle damage Skid marks or debris Road conditions Traffic signs

Admitting Fault at the Scene
One of the biggest mistakes you can make is confessing fault right away following a mishap. It's suggested to prevent discussing fault till all realities are gathered.
Failing to Look for Medical Attention Immediately
Even if injuries seem small, it's important to get inspected by a health care professional right away; some injuries may not manifest symptoms immediately.

1. What should I do instantly following a vehicle accident?
Immediately look for injuries, call emergency situation services, exchange information with other parties involved, and record the scene.
2. The length of time do I have to file a claim after my vehicle accident?
In California, you generally have 2 years from the date of the accident to file a personal injury claim.
3. Can I still recover damages if I was partly at fault?
Yes, California follows relative neglect laws which allow you to recover damages even if you're partially at fault; however, your settlement may be decreased accordingly.
4. Ought to I speak with my insurer before seeking advice from a lawyer?
It's a good idea to seek advice from a lawyer before going over information about the mishap with your insurance coverage company.
5. What types of settlement can I seek after an auto accident?
You can seek settlement for medical costs, lost salaries, pain and suffering, property damage, and more.
